Basic Information

Item Details
Product Name 2-Thiazolecarboxaldehyde, 4-(Methoxymethyl)- (9Ci)
CAS No. 211943-03-2
Molecular Formula C7H9NO2S
Molecular Weight 171.22 g/mol
Synonyms 4-(Methoxymethyl)thiazole-2-carboxaldehyde; 4-(Methoxymethyl)-2-thiazolecarboxaldehyde; 2-Formyl-4-(methoxymethyl)thiazole; 4-Methoxymethyl-2-thiazolecarboxaldehyde; 4-Methoxymethylthiazole-2-carbaldehyde; 211943-03-2; Thiazole-2-carboxaldehyde, 4-(methoxymethyl)-

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at a controlled room temperature (15-25°C). This compound is easily oxidized; for long-term storage, consider keeping under an inert atmosphere such as nitrogen or argon.
